

.config{


    margin-top: 90px;  
    
}


#content-videos{
    margin-top: 102px;
    background-image: linear-gradient(to bottom right,#0f006d, #f60);
}

#fundador {

    margin-top: 100px;
}

#fundador h2 {

    position: relative;
    color: #0f006d;
    font-size: 24px;
    font-weight: 300;
    text-transform: uppercase;
}

#fundador img{

    margin-bottom: 10px;    
}

.titulo{


    width: 75%;
    margin: 0 auto;
}


.titulo h2{

    background: -webkit-linear-gradient( #0f006d, #f60);
    -webkit-background-clip: text;
     -webkit-text-fill-color: transparent;
    text-align: center;
    font-weight: 350;
}

.menu-fixo{
    position:fixed;
    right:0;
    top:50%;
    display:flex;
    margin-top:-150px;
    align-self:center;
    background-image: linear-gradient(to bottom right,#0f006d, #f60);
    width:106px;
    height:380px;
    z-index:1029;
    flex-direction:column;
    justify-content:center;
    -webkit-box-shadow:0 0 8px 1px rgba(0,0,0,.42);
    -moz-box-shadow:0 0 8px 1px rgba(0,0,0,.42);
    box-shadow:0 0 8px 1px rgba(0,0,0,.42);
    align-items:center;
    border-radius: 10px;
    opacity: 0.9;
}
.menu-fixo a{
    color:#747474
}
.menu-fixo a:hover{
    text-decoration:none
}
.menu-fixo .item{
    text-align:center;
    justify-content:center
}
.menu-fixo .item p{
    text-align:center;
    color:#ffff;
    font-size:15px;
    margin-top:8px;
    margin-bottom:10px
}

@media only screen and (max-width: 768px) {
  
    .menu-fixo{
        position:fixed;
        right:0;
        top:60%;
        display:flex;
        margin-top:-150px;
        align-self:center;
        background-image: linear-gradient(to bottom right,#0f006d, #f60);
        width:50px;
        height:300px;
        z-index:1029;
        flex-direction:column;
        justify-content:center;
        -webkit-box-shadow:0 0 8px 1px rgba(0,0,0,.42);
        -moz-box-shadow:0 0 8px 1px rgba(0,0,0,.42);
        box-shadow:0 0 8px 1px rgba(0,0,0,.42);
        align-items:center;
        border-radius: 10px;
        opacity: 0.9;
    }
    .menu-fixo a {
        color:#747474
    }
    .menu-fixo a:hover {
        text-decoration:none
    }
    .menu-fixo .item {
        text-align:center;
        justify-content:center
    }
    .menu-fixo .item p {
        text-align:center;
        color:#ffff;
        font-size:10px;
        margin-top:8px;
        margin-bottom:10px
    }

    .menu-fixo .item img {

        width:45px; 
        height:45px;
    }
}
hr{

    margin-top: -1px;
    border-color: #0f006d;
}

.separator {

    margin: 0 auto;
    margin-top:50px;
    margin-bottom: 50px;
   
}

.separator .item{

    margin: 10px 10px 10px 10px;
}





